ФЕДЕРАЛЬНОЕ ГОСУДАРСТВЕННОЕ БЮДЖЕТНОЕ ОБРАЗОВАТЕЛЬНОЕ УЧРЕЖДЕНИЕ ВЫСШЕГО ПРОФЕССИОНАЛЬНОГО ОБРАЗОВАНИЯ
УФИМСКИЙ ГОСУДАРСТВЕННЫЙ АВИАЦИОННЫЙ ТЕХНИЧЕСКИЙ УНИВЕРСИТЕТ
Кафедра экономической информатики
ИЗУЧЕНИЕ ИНТЕГРИРОВАННОЙ СРЕДЫ BORLAND C++.
Вложенные циклы методические указания
к лабораторным работам по курсу «Программирование»
Уфа 2012
Составитель: Е.И. Филосова
ББК
УДК 519.682
Методические указания к лабораторным работам по курсу «Программирование» для студентов направления 080500 «БИЗНЕС ИНФОРМАТИКА » / Уфимский государственный авиационный технический университет; Составитель Е.И. Филосова, Уфа, 2006 - 10с.
В методических указаниях представлена лабораторная работа по изучению раздела «Изучение интегрированной среды Borland C++. Вложенные циклы» дисциплины «Программирование». Представлены примеры, контрольные вопросы и задания для самостоятельной работы. Методические указания могут быть так же использованы в курсовом и дипломном проектировании.
Ил. 4, табл. 0
Рецензенты: доц.
доц.
© Уфимский государственный авиационный технический университет, 2012
Содержание
Цель работы 5
Задачи занятия: 5
1 Общие положения 5
1.1 Операторы цикла 5
1.2 Вложенные циклы 6
2 Задание 7
3 Контрольные вопросы 7
4Требования к отчету 7
Приложение А 8
Задания на повторение с использованием операторов цикла 8
Приложение Б 10
Задания на вычисление значения выражений с использованием вложенных операторов цикла 10
Цель работы
Изучить циклические алгоритмы.
Задачи занятия:
Повторить основные операторы циклов языка С++;
Проработать примеры программ с использованием различных видов циклов, вложенных друг в друга;
Написать и отладить программы, реализующие разработанные алгоритмы;
Составить и защитить отчет.
1 Общие положения
1.1 Операторы цикла
Операторы цикла используются для организации многократно повторяющихся вычислений. Для удобства в C++ есть три разных оператора цикла - while, do while и for.
Для организации цикла с известным числом повторений в языке C++ используется оператор for. Он имеет следующий формат:
For ( выражение_1 ; выражение_2 ; выражение_3 ) оператор;
Выражение 1 – выражение инициализации, обычно используется для установления начального значения переменных, управляющих циклом. Выражение 2 – это выражение, определяющее условие, при котором тело цикла будет выполняться. Выражение 3 – выражение итерации, определяет изменение переменных, управляющих циклом после каждого выполнения тела цикла.
Оператор цикла while называется циклом с предусловием и имеет следующий формат:
While ( выражение ) оператор;
Оператор цикла с предусловием действует таким образом: dычисляется выражение и если оно не равно нулю, то выполняется оператор. Если выражение равно нулю, то оператор WHILE прекращает свою работу.
Оператор цикла do while называется оператором цикла с постусловием и используется в тех случаях, когда необходимо выполнить операторы, образующие тело цикла, хотя бы один раз. Формат оператора имеет следующий вид: